"The Works has been a great go-to book for thousands of teachers for the last 25 years. Poetry needs space, time and ‘air’ so that children can find it, browse it, hear it and speak it. The Works does the work.” - Michael Rosen
The Works poetry collection is 25 years old! This special anniversary edition features brand-new lesson plans from poets including John Foster, Brian Moses, Valerie Bloom and Pie Corbett.
The Works contains every kind of poem you will ever need for school, but it is also a book packed with brilliant poems that will delight any reader.
It's got chants, action verses, riddles, tongue twisters, shape poems, puns, acrostics, haikus, cinquains, kennings, couplets, thin poems, lists, conversations, monologues, epitaphs, songs, limericks, tankas, nonsense poems, raps, narrative verse and performance poetry that's just for starters.
This WHOPPING 25th anniversary edition of the poetry classic, compiled and edited by Paul Cookson and published by Pan Macmillan, is organised to help students and teachers find poems based on specific criteria (like style, subject or author).
